Determining Your Texas Commercial Insurance Needs
When you are shopping for commercial insurance in Texas, it helps to know what is required of you and your business. Depending on your business size and type, you may require Texas liability insurance, worker’s compensation coverage, commercial property insurance, a business owner’s policy, or one or more of many other policy offerings. Sorting through everything on offer is difficult at best, and finding the right coverage for your business and your budget is essential.
What You Need to Know About Texas Commercial Insurance
• Most businesses are required to have Texas
insurance before they begin operations.
• The type of business you own will determine
the policy requirements.
• Not all policies cover events such as floods.
Review your policy details and purchase any
additional coverage that may be necessary.
• Read all terms and exclusions before signing
any policy documents.
• When possible, seek multiple Texas liability
insurance quotes and other policy quotes and look for multi-policy discounts.
• Always ensure that you are providing coverage for rented and leased equipment as well as for valuable documents and even intangible goods such as trademarks.
